The Nosferatu get everyone's secrets and all the dirty laundry. Want to know what happened in Iran-Contra? Ask the Nosferatu. Need to know who's really responsible for Whitewater? Ask the Nosferatu. They control the metro system. They search through the trash. They know the dark, secret underbelly of D.C. They know which Bone Gnawers had a bit too much vampire blood to drink. They can tell you the location of the Setite temple and the latest area of Sabbat infiltration. Of course, everything has a price, or requires a favor. Knowledge isn't free.
Vampire: The Masquerade - D.C. By Night
